Output dd343f914b2415d32de6fd21e1f5443befc120060c32faa66ad2a3613777d9b9:12

value
2069672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0429ae0bc38260e504f36191f8935c705b40535 OP_EQUAL
address
3GJPq2qqFtnzzPABNTP2W6BJGEqr2HgE8x
transaction
dd343f914b2415d32de6fd21e1f5443befc120060c32faa66ad2a3613777d9b9
spent
true